Jquery 设置了[F]标志的eRule不确定它在哪里http://primaryman.com/pare/assets/images/summit/slider/您关心的返回403的url?是的,其中一个,http://primaryman.com/pare/ass
Jquery 设置了[F]标志的eRule不确定它在哪里http://primaryman.com/pare/assets/images/summit/slider/您关心的返回403的url?是的,其中一个,http://primaryman.com/pare/ass,jquery,ajax,get,http-status-code-403,Jquery,Ajax,Get,Http Status Code 403,设置了[F]标志的eRule不确定它在哪里http://primaryman.com/pare/assets/images/summit/slider/您关心的返回403的url?是的,其中一个,http://primaryman.com/pare/assets/images/royce/slider/也http://primaryman.com/pare/assets/images/ {{differentname}}/slider/发出此请求时,请发布浏览器开发工具中显示的请求标题和响应标
设置了
[F]
标志的eRule不确定它在哪里http://primaryman.com/pare/assets/images/summit/slider/
您关心的返回403的url?是的,其中一个,http://primaryman.com/pare/assets/images/royce/slider/
也http://primaryman.com/pare/assets/images/ {{differentname}}/slider/
发出此请求时,请发布浏览器开发工具中显示的请求标题和响应标题。处理请求的PHP脚本也会很有帮助。最后,控制对该PHP脚本的访问的htaccess文件可能是罪魁祸首(特别是任何具有[F]的重写规则)
flag set不确定它在哪里http://primaryman.com/pare/assets/images/summit/slider/
您关心的返回403的url?是的,其中一个,http://primaryman.com/pare/assets/images/royce/slider/
也http://primaryman.com/pare/assets/images/ {{differentname}}/slider/
$.ajax({
url: url,
success: function(data) {
var parser = new DOMParser(),
doc = parser.parseFromString(data, 'text/html');
var rows = doc.querySelector('table').querySelectorAll('tr');
for (var i=0;i<rows.length;i++) {
if (rows[i].children[2]) {
var img = rows[i].children[2].children[0].getAttribute("href");
if(img.match(/\.(jpeg|jpg|gif|png)$/) != null){
var html = '<li id="" style="background-image: url('+img+')"></li>';
$('#nikoSlider ul').append(html)
} else { console.log("This is not a valid image type: " + img) }
}
}
nikoSlider();
}
});
url: '/path/to/slider_images.php?collection=royce //<- or collection=summit
$path = "/pare/assets/images/$_GET[collection]/slider/"
echo json_encode($images);
<?php
$filenameArray = array();
$summit = array();
$royce = array();
$soundview = array();
$merrit = array();
$hillcroft = array();
$all = array();
$handle = opendir(dirname(realpath(__FILE__)).'/assets/images/summit/slider/');
while($file = readdir($handle)){
if($file !== '.' && $file !== '..'){
array_push($filenameArray, "assets/images/summit/slider/$file");
array_push($summit, "assets/images/summit/slider/$file");
}
}
array_push($all, $summit);
$handle = opendir(dirname(realpath(__FILE__)).'/assets/images/royce/slider/');
while($file = readdir($handle)){
if($file !== '.' && $file !== '..'){
array_push($filenameArray, "assets/images/royce/slider/$file");
array_push($royce, "assets/images/royce/slider/$file");
}
}
array_push($all, $royce);
$handle = opendir(dirname(realpath(__FILE__)).'/assets/images/soundview/slider/');
while($file = readdir($handle)){
if($file !== '.' && $file !== '..'){
array_push($filenameArray, "assets/images/soundview/slider/$file");
array_push($soundview, "assets/images/soundview/slider/$file");
}
}
array_push($all, $soundview);
$handle = opendir(dirname(realpath(__FILE__)).'/assets/images/merrit-station/slider/');
while($file = readdir($handle)){
if($file !== '.' && $file !== '..'){
array_push($filenameArray, "assets/images/merrit-station/slider/$file");
array_push($merrit, "assets/images/merrit-station/slider/$file");
}
}
array_push($all, $merrit);
$handle = opendir(dirname(realpath(__FILE__)).'/assets/images/hillcroft-danbury/slider/');
while($file = readdir($handle)){
if($file !== '.' && $file !== '..'){
array_push($filenameArray, "assets/images/hillcroft-danbury/slider/$file");
array_push($hillcroft, "assets/images/hillcroft-danbury/slider/$file");
}
}
array_push($all, $hillcroft);
echo json_encode($all);
?>
$(document).ready(function(){/* Loop thru images folder */
var page = ['summit','royce','soundview','merrit-station','hillcroft-danburmer'].indexOf(window.location.href.split('/').pop())
console.log(page);
var url = "allow.php";
$.ajax({
url: url,
dataType: "json",
success: function(data) {
console.log(data);
console.log(data);
$.each(data[page], function(i,filename) {
console.log(filename);
var img = filename;
var arr = img.split('/');
console.log(arr[arr.length-3])
if(img.match(/\.(jpeg|jpg|gif|png)$/) != null && arr[arr.length-3] == window.location.href.split('/').pop()){
var html = '<li id="" style="background-image: url('+img+')"></li>';
$('#nikoSlider ul').append(html)
console.log(html);
} else { console.log("This is not a valid image type: " + img) }
})
nikoSlider();
}
});
//rows[i].children[2] $(rows[i].children[2]).find('attr', 'href').context.textContent $(rows[i].children[2]).text() rows[i].children[2].querySelector('a')['href']
})